Medical Device Industry Growth in 2025
The medical device sector continues to grow due to an aging population, chronic diseases, digital health adoption, and rising global healthcare spending.
Key Market Statistics for 2025
Data Point
2025 Estimate
Source
Global market value
USD 650 to 720 billion
WHO, Fortune Business Insights
CAGR growth rate
5 to 6 percent
Markets and Markets
Digital health growth
15 percent CAGR
Deloitte
Wearable device adoption
Over 1.1 billion users
Statista
These numbers show strong and steady demand for innovative and reliable medical technologies.
Important Trends Shaping 2025
1. Growth in Minimally Invasive Devices
Healthcare systems prefer devices that reduce hospital stays, lower infection risk, and improve recovery times. Demand for catheters, endoscopic tools, and implantable devices keeps rising across all regions.
2. Expansion of Connected and Smart Devices
Smart sensors, cloud linked monitors, and digital diagnostics support remote care. Governments and health organizations support remote monitoring for long term disease management. The FDA continues to release updated guidance for software as a medical device.
3. Strong Focus on Supply Chain Resilience
Manufacturers now invest in safe sourcing, automation, and risk mitigation. Many companies diversify production across regions to avoid delays and supply shortages.
4. Higher Demand for Biocompatible and Sustainable Materials
Eco friendly materials, reusable components, and low waste manufacturing are important as hospitals follow sustainability goals. These changes influence product design, packaging, and sterilization.
5. Rise in Diagnostic and Point of Care Devices
Point of care testing supports faster clinical decisions. Rapid diagnostics see strong growth due to global health awareness.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is driving growth in the medical device industry in 2025?
Aging populations, chronic illness, digital health programs, and better healthcare access drive global demand.
What segment is growing the fastest?
Digital health devices, wearables, and point of care testing show the strongest growth.
Are regulatory requirements increasing?
Yes. Agencies like the FDA and EU MDR require clearer documentation, better risk management, and strong quality systems.
How are smart devices affecting the market?
Smart devices support remote care, early diagnosis, and better patient monitoring. This increases adoption across hospitals and home care.
